DETACHED 1930'S FAMILY HOME WITH A DRIVEWAY, GOOD SIZE WESTERLY ASPECT GARDEN AND EXCELLENT POTENTIAL CLOSE TO MAINLINE TRAIN LINKS.
Located within the popular village of South Merstham close to a parade of local shops and just around the corner from some of Surrey's wonderful countryside, this detached 1930's built house has a great plot and offers excellent scope for modernisation and extension (STPP)
On the ground floor there is an entrance hall with an under stairs storage cupboard that has a double glazed window to the side and plumbing for a WC. You have a dual aspect living space that runs front to back and serves as both a lounge and dining area, beyond the living space there is a handy sun room this is of timber construction and overlooks the lovely garden. Off the hallway there is an extended kitchen that has a double glazed window to both the side and the rear as well as a side door. On the first floor there is a landing with a double glazed window to the side and loft access, you have two good size double bedrooms, a single bedroom and a family bathroom.
Outside there is a walled boundary to the front and a lawn garden, you have a driveway that runs up past the side of the house and provides off road parking in tandem for 4 cars. At the rear there is an 80ft westerly aspect that is mainly laid to lawn with fence boundaries. Nearby you have the benefit of a number of local shops and food outlets as well as a Tesco Express within the Watercolour development. Merstham boasts a number of schools as well as some lovely walks and nature reserves.
